The effect of amiodarone, a new anti-anginal drug, on cardiac muscle.

作者信息

Singh B N, Vaughan Williams E M

出版信息

Br J Pharmacol. 1970 Aug;39(4):657-67. doi: 10.1111/j.1476-5381.1970.tb09891.x.

Abstract
  1. Amiodarone (2-butyl, 3-(4-diethylaminoethoxy, 3,5-diiodo, benzoyl) benzofuran hydrochloride), an anti-anginal drug which causes coronary dilatation and depresses myocardial oxygen consumption, was found to protect anaesthetized guinea-pigs against ouabain-induced ventricular fibrillation.2. A 5% (73.4 mM) solution of amiodarone had no local anaesthetic action on guinea-pig skin.3. Amiodarone, 20 mg/kg (29.4 mumol/kg) given daily for 6 weeks intraperitoneally, had no effect on the resting potential or action potential height, and only a small effect on the maximum rate of depolarization, of isolated rabbit atrial or ventricular muscle fibres as shown by intracellular recording. It caused a considerable prolongation of the action potential in both tissues.4. Simultaneous administration of thyroxine (5 mug; 6.26 nmol), given daily for 3 weeks intraperitoneally, prevented the prolongation by amiodarone of the duration of the action potential.5. Treatment of rabbits with 20 mg/kg of amiodarone daily intraperitoneally for 6 weeks had no effect on the weight of the thyroid gland, but was associated with a reduction in body growth rate.6. Treatment of rabbits with 10 mg/kg (60.3 mumol/kg) of potassium iodide (equal in its iodine content to that of 20 mg/kg of amiodarone), given daily for 6 weeks intraperitoneally, had no effect on body growth rate or the duration of cardiac action potentials.7. It was concluded that amiodarone had effects on cardiac action potentials similar to those which occur after thyroidectomy.
摘要
  1. 胺碘酮(2 - 丁基 - 3 -(4 - 二乙氨基乙氧基)- 3,5 - 二碘苯甲酰基苯并呋喃盐酸盐)是一种抗心绞痛药物,可引起冠状动脉扩张并降低心肌耗氧量,已发现它能保护麻醉的豚鼠免受哇巴因诱导的心室颤动。

  2. 5%(73.4 mM)的胺碘酮溶液对豚鼠皮肤无局部麻醉作用。

  3. 如细胞内记录所示,腹腔内每日给予20 mg/kg(29.4 μmol/kg)胺碘酮,持续6周,对离体兔心房或心室肌纤维的静息电位或动作电位高度无影响,对最大去极化速率仅有轻微影响。它使两种组织的动作电位显著延长。

  4. 腹腔内每日同时给予甲状腺素(5 μg;6.26 nmol),持续3周,可防止胺碘酮引起的动作电位持续时间延长。

  5. 腹腔内每日用20 mg/kg胺碘酮治疗家兔6周,对甲状腺重量无影响,但与体重生长速率降低有关。

  6. 腹腔内每日用10 mg/kg(60.3 μmol/kg)碘化钾(碘含量与20 mg/kg胺碘酮相等)治疗家兔6周,对体重生长速率或心脏动作电位持续时间无影响。

  7. 得出的结论是,胺碘酮对心脏动作电位的影响与甲状腺切除术后出现的影响相似。
